Post Shoulder Injury Total Gym

QUESTION:

I am 51, active with work, not exercise.  Just finished four months with Doctor and Physical Therapist freeing up a frozen shoulder manipulation and therapy no surgery required.

Just purchased a Total Gym and have done limited work (two days) not sure what I should and should not do as far the shoulder goes.  Any help will be greatly appreciated. Thank you much

ANSWER:

Four months is a long time to rehabilitate an injury.  Your PT should have given you a list of preventative exercises to continue and limitations for your physical activity and workouts.  Without this knowledge I really have no business instructing you on what you should and should not do.  You don't want to reverse all your hard work not to mention your PT and doctor's with misinformed exercise selection.

General recommendations when deealing with injuries is always exercise within your envelope of function, simply put, if it hurts don't do it. Due to shoulder structure injuries are more likely compared to most joints so be careful.  It is probably best to avoid any overhead exercises or any other exercises which put the shoulders at risk with extreme ranges of motion.  Also make sure to avoid excessive repetitive motion. 

Make sure you mix things up and stretch after and in between subsequent workouts.  Here are a bunch of exercise videos for the Total Gym.  Make sure to perform all your movements under complete control and again, if it hurts (like it's not supposed to) don't do it.
